Class Processor

Class Processor

Название пространства: Aspose.Words.LowCode Ассоциация: Aspose.Words.dll (25.4.0)

Класс процессора для выполнения различных действий обработки документов.

public class Processor

Inheritance

object Processor

Derived

Comparer , Converter , MailMerger , Merger , Replacer , ReportBuilder , Splitter , Watermarker

Наследованные члены

object.GetType() , object.MemberwiseClone() , object.ToString() , object.Equals(object?) , object.Equals(object?, object?) , object.ReferenceEquals(object?, object?) , object.GetHashCode()

Fields

mResultДокумент

protected Document mResultDocument

Полевая ценность

Document

Methods

CheckArgumentsSet()

protected virtual void CheckArgumentsSet()

Execute()

Используйте действие процессора.

public void Execute()

ExecuteCore()

protected virtual void ExecuteCore()

From(Стриг, LoadOptions)

Определяет входный документ для обработки.

public Processor From(string input, LoadOptions loadOptions = null)

Parameters

input string

Введите имя файла документа.

loadOptions LoadOptions

Опциональные опции зарядки, используемые для загрузки документа.

Returns

Processor

Обратитесь к процессору с установленным входным файлом.

Remarks

Если процессор принимает только один файл в качестве ввода, будет обрабатываться только последний указанный файл.Aspose.Words.LowCode.Merger процессор принимает несколько файлов в качестве ввода, в результате все указанные документы будут объединены.Aspose.Words.LowCode.Converter процессор принимает только один файл в качестве ввода, поэтому будет конвертирован только последний указанный файл.

From(Поток, LoadOptions)

Определяет входный документ для обработки.

public Processor From(Stream input, LoadOptions loadOptions = null)

Parameters

input Stream

Входный документ Stream.

loadOptions LoadOptions

Опциональные опции зарядки, используемые для загрузки документа.

Returns

Processor

Обратитесь к процессору с установленным потоком входных файлов.

Remarks

Если процессор принимает только один файл в качестве ввода, будет обрабатываться только последний указанный файл.Aspose.Words.LowCode.Merger процессор принимает несколько файлов в качестве ввода, в результате все указанные документы будут объединены.Aspose.Words.LowCode.Converter процессор принимает только один файл в качестве ввода, поэтому будет конвертирован только последний указанный файл.

GetPartFileName(Стриг, int, SaveFormat)

protected static string GetPartFileName(string fileName, int partIndex, SaveFormat saveFormat)

Parameters

fileName string

partIndex int

saveFormat SaveFormat

Returns

string

To(Стриг, SaveOptions)

Определяет выходной файл для процессора.

public Processor To(string output, SaveOptions saveOptions = null)

Parameters

output string

Имя выхода файла.

saveOptions SaveOptions

Опциональные варианты сохранения. если не указано, формат хранения определяется расширением файла.

Returns

Processor

Обратитесь к процессору с определенным выходом файла.

Remarks

Если вывод состоит из нескольких файлов, то для создания названия файла используется указанное имя вывода.Для каждой части следует следующее правило: «outputFile_partIndex.extension».

To(Стриг, SaveFormat)

Определяет выходной файл для процессора.

public Processor To(string output, SaveFormat saveFormat)

Parameters

output string

Имя выхода файла.

saveFormat SaveFormat

Скачать формат. если не указано, скачать формат определяется расширением файла.

Returns

Processor

Обратитесь к процессору с определенным выходом файла.

Remarks

Если вывод состоит из нескольких файлов, то для создания названия файла используется указанное имя вывода.Для каждой части следует следующее правило: «outputFile_partIndex.extension».

To(Поток, SaveOptions)

Определяет источник выхода для процессора.

public Processor To(Stream output, SaveOptions saveOptions)

Parameters

output Stream

Выходный поток .

saveOptions SaveOptions

Сохраните варианты.

Returns

Processor

Процессор возвращается с определенным потоком выхода.

Remarks

Если вывод состоит из нескольких файлов, только первая часть будет сохранена в указанный поток.

To(Поток, SaveFormat)

Определяет источник выхода для процессора.

public Processor To(Stream output, SaveFormat saveFormat)

Parameters

output Stream

Выходный поток .

saveFormat SaveFormat

Скачать формат .

Returns

Processor

Процессор возвращается с определенным потоком выхода.

Remarks

Если вывод состоит из нескольких файлов, только первая часть будет сохранена в указанный поток.

To(Список «Stream»>, SaveOptions)

Определите список потоков выхода документа.

public Processor To(List<stream> output, SaveOptions saveOptions)

Parameters

output List • < Stream >

Список потоков выхода документа.

saveOptions SaveOptions

Сохраните варианты.

Returns

Processor

Обработка возвращается процессором с указанным списком потоков документа выхода.

Remarks

Если вывод состоит из нескольких файлов (например, изображений или разделенных деталей документа), к указанному списку добавляется поток для каждой части.Если вывод является одним файлом, в список добавляется только один поток.Ответственность конечного пользователя заключается в распоряжении созданных потоков.

To(Список «Stream»>, → SaveFormat)

Определите список потоков выхода документа.

public Processor To(List<stream> output, SaveFormat saveFormat)

Parameters

output List • < Stream >

Список потоков выхода документа.

saveFormat SaveFormat

Скачать формат .

Returns

Processor

Обработка возвращается процессором с указанным списком потоков документа выхода.

Remarks

Если вывод состоит из нескольких файлов (например, изображений или разделенных деталей документа), к указанному списку добавляется поток для каждой части.Если вывод является одним файлом, в список добавляется только один поток.Ответственность конечного пользователя заключается в распоряжении созданных потоков.

 Русский